FYI, the FEC works fine for me in U-Boot for another i.MX25 board using a Micrel PHY. That required some patches for 2012.07, but they are now in u-boot/master. There are also some i.MX25 patches in u-boot-imx/next that might help, but I don't think that they were needed to make FEC work. However, I haven't updated yet to 2012.10-rc3, so there might be a regression somewhere, or an issue with the PHY.
